02-04-2013 6:06 PM
Dear all,
is there an authorization object available that can be used e.g. to restrict maintenance in SU01 for a special parameter id (e.g. UGR)?
What I found so far is that it might be possible with a transaction variant. But this is not the preferred way. Any ideas?
Thanks in advance for you assistance.
02-04-2013 11:25 PM
Not possible with standard objects.
But SU01 for SAPGUI access is actually just one big fat function module and there is an implicit enhancement point at the start of all functions. So based on a check of your own you can set the screen or hide the tab or what ever you want.
That amounts to the same as a transaction variant in my books.
Users can anyway change their own PIDs.
Perhaps you can explain exactly why you want this and what the control requirement is?
Help desk? Users changing their own PIDs?
Sometimes there are also better transactions for the user to have access to: Su50? SU2?
Cheers,
Julius
02-04-2013 11:25 PM
Not possible with standard objects.
But SU01 for SAPGUI access is actually just one big fat function module and there is an implicit enhancement point at the start of all functions. So based on a check of your own you can set the screen or hide the tab or what ever you want.
That amounts to the same as a transaction variant in my books.
Users can anyway change their own PIDs.
Perhaps you can explain exactly why you want this and what the control requirement is?
Help desk? Users changing their own PIDs?
Sometimes there are also better transactions for the user to have access to: Su50? SU2?
Cheers,
Julius